Understanding Ohio's Sexual Abuse Laws in Healthcare

Ohio’s sexual abuse laws in healthcare are designed to protect patients and hold accountable those who violate their trust. The state has stringent regulations governing professional conduct, particularly in the medical field. Any form of non-consensual sexual contact or behavior by a healthcare provider towards a patient is considered assault and battery, with severe legal repercussions. Doctor lawyers in Cleveland, OH, emphasize that these laws are essential to ensure patients’ safety and privacy.
The Ohio Revised Code outlines specific provisions related to sexual misconduct by medical professionals. For instance, Section 2901.01 defines sexual contact and conduct that constitutes assault, while Chapter 2305 addresses civil liabilities for medical malpractice, including sexual abuse. Patients who have suffered sexual harassment or assault at the hands of a doctor in Ohio have legal recourse to seek compensation for their injuries. These cases often require meticulous documentation and evidence collection, as well as the expertise of specialized lawyer teams.
A key aspect of understanding these laws is recognizing the importance of informed consent. Healthcare providers must obtain a patient’s explicit agreement before any examination or procedure, ensuring they are fully aware of what will happen. Failure to obtain consent or violation of a patient’s privacy can lead to criminal charges and civil lawsuits. Doctor lawyers in Cleveland, OH, advise medical professionals to maintain thorough records and adhere strictly to ethical guidelines to avoid legal complications.

Recognizing Red Flags: Patient Safety Strategies

In the sensitive realm of healthcare, patient safety is paramount, especially when addressing allegations of sexual abuse. Ohio has seen a rise in claims against healthcare providers, underscoring the critical need for recognition and prevention strategies. Doctor lawyers Cleveland OH emphasize that early identification of red flags is essential to mitigate risks and protect vulnerable patients. These professionals advise medical facilities to implement robust protocols and encourage staff to remain vigilant.
One significant red flag involves suspicious behavior from healthcare workers, such as inappropriate physical contact or sudden changes in treatment approaches. For instance, a patient might notice a doctor exhibiting excessive personal interest or engaging in unusual interactions outside the clinical setting. Additionally, any history of similar allegations against a provider should raise concerns. Data suggests that many cases go unreported, making it crucial for medical institutions to have robust reporting mechanisms and encourage patients to voice their fears without fear of retaliation.
To enhance patient safety, healthcare organizations in Cleveland OH should foster an open and supportive environment where staff can discuss potential issues confidentially. Regular training sessions focusing on consent, boundaries, and ethical conduct are essential. Moreover, utilizing technology for secure communication channels between patients and doctors can deter inappropriate behavior. By combining these strategies, medical facilities can create a more robust defense against sexual abuse claims and ensure patient well-being.

Support and Resources for Survivors: A Comprehensive Guide

Surviving sexual abuse by a healthcare provider is a deeply traumatic experience, often shrouded in secrecy due to shame, fear, or concerns about trust. At such times, it’s crucial for survivors to know that they are not alone and that there are resources available to help them heal. In Ohio, with its robust legal framework and dedicated support systems, survivors can access critical assistance from doctor lawyers in Cleveland OH who specialize in medical malpractice and sexual abuse cases. These professionals offer a much-needed combination of legal counsel and emotional support.
The journey towards healing begins with recognizing the severity of the trauma and taking action. One of the first steps is to report the incident to local law enforcement or appropriate authorities, ensuring that the abuser faces legal consequences. Subsequently, seeking therapy from mental health professionals experienced in treating survivors of sexual abuse becomes vital. These experts can help process emotions, rebuild self-esteem, and develop coping mechanisms. Additionally, support groups facilitate connections with peers who have gone through similar experiences, fostering a sense of community and understanding.
Practical resources include non-profit organizations dedicated to assisting victims of medical sexual misconduct. They provide legal aid, counseling services, and educational materials tailored to the unique needs of survivors. For instance, organizations like the National Sexual Assault Hotline (1-800-656-HOPE) offer confidential support and can connect individuals with local resources in Cleveland OH.
